Mercedes-Benz is often a symbol of luxurious, innovation, and fulfillment. When your prized Mercedes needs fix or upkeep, it deserves the utmost treatment and experience. In Tauranga, New Zealand, discerning Mercedes proprietors get entry to a premier destination for Mercedes repairs, a location that guarantees their fine vehicles are restored to p… Read More